The phrase "analyse the level of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the depth or extent of a particular subject, concept, or phenomenon in a detailed manner.
Example: "In this report, we will analyse the level of customer satisfaction with our services over the past year."
Alternatives: "assess the degree of" or "evaluate the extent of".
